The video discusses the diverging prices of bonds, investor confidence in the offshore market, and concerns about debt restructuring in China. It highlights the attractiveness of the Chinese bond market due to strong inflows and interest rate differentials. The impact of inflation on market volatility and the challenges of navigating data distortions for forecasting are also covered.
